About H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L

Set in NEW WINDSOR, New York, H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L is a substantial junior high, run under NEWBURGH CITY SCHOOL DISTRICT. It hosts 802 students across grades 6 through 8. Enrollment runs roughly 51% above the state mean of about 531.

NEWBURGH CITY SCHOOL DISTRICT comprises 12 schools with combined enrollment of 10,762 students; H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L is among them.

For racial and ethnic makeup, H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L shows that Hispanic students make up the majority at 62%. The remainder is composed of 21% Black, 12% White, 4% multiracial. The wider county runs roughly 24% Hispanic, putting the school's mix noticeably more Hispanic than the area baseline.

Looking at school resources, The school lists 77 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 10.4:1. That tracks the state average closely. Roughly 44% of students at H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ment.

Adjusting for the school's free-and-reduced-lunch share, H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 58.8%; this one delivers 48.3%.

In the broader community, community-level numbers for Orange County indicate the typical household earns roughly $97,178 per year, about 33%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 9%. H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L is one of 82 public schools in Orange County (combined enrollment of about 57,122 students).

TEMPLE HILL SCHOOL is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.6 miles from this campus. 8 of the 8 nearest public schools sit inside a five-mile radius. Among the 8 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), HERITAGE MIDDLE SCHOOL ranks 3rd on composite proficiency, beneath the local average of 50.8%.

The school occupies a bedroom-community site.

Trend over the last 7 years. Over the past 7-year window, the student count edged down 11%: 902 students in 2018 compared to 802 in 2025. The Hispanic share of enrollment rose from 46% to 62% over that span. The student-to-teacher ratio tightened from 12.0:1 in 2018 to 10.4:1 today.
